II. The body of the summary
4. Firstly, the author describes Maugham’s early life.
5. He was born in Paris and worked as a doctor.
6. Secondly, it is stated that his novel “Of Human Bondage” is very honest.
7. It tells the story of a young man named Philip Carey.
8. Moreover, the author discusses “The Moon and Sixpence”.
9. This novel is based on the painter Paul Gauguin.
10. Thirdly, Maugham’s short stories and plays are considered.
11. His style is simple but clever, and people still read his books today.
